3. Materials Science Innovations

MNT relies on "exotic" materials that don't exist yet for assemblers and products.

  • Diamondoid and Stiff Nanostructures: Engineer ultra-rigid, low-friction materials (e.g., carbon-based diamondoids) for nanobot components to withstand thermal vibrations (Brownian motion). Breakthrough: Synthesis of large-scale diamondoid lattices via MNT itself, providing the stiffness needed for precise atomic placement without deformation.
